Madhu Goud Yaskhi (born 15 December 1960) is a member of the
14th Lok Sabha of
India. He represents the
Nizamabad constituency of
Andhra Pradesh and is a member of the
Indian National Congress (INC) political party.
He is a strong supporter for the formation of a new state in southern India,
Telengana, for which the people are fighting to be carved out of the existing state of Andhra Pradesh and has popular support from the people of
Telangana.
Early life
Madhu Yaskhi was born on 15 December 1960 to Kistaiah Goud and Sulochana. He is the second among six sisters and three brothers. He was adopted by his father's younger brother Pochaiah Goud and Anasuya.
He has Bachelor's degree in Arts from Nizam College, Hyderabad in 1982. He also obtained an LLB from the University of Delhi in 1985 and LLM from P. G. College of Law, Hyderabad in 1989.
Career
Madhu Yaskhi was a
New York attorney. He established International Legal and Trade Consultants. This organization provides legal assistance to people of Indian origin. Moved by the plight of farmers committing suicides due to crop failures and high debts, he left USA and returned to India. He has a law firm in New York and Atlanta, still actively working through remote operations and few visits every few months.
